&lt;p&gt;Our Scrum Master, made a small free/open-source tool for Azure DevOps because sprint setup and work item admin kept taking more time than it should.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;It’s mainly for things like sprint templates, easier work item linking, spotting missing estimates/stale items, and getting a better overview without jumping/clicking through a bunch of screens.&lt;/p&gt;
